One of the primary problems addressed by flat roof vent installation is excess moisture accumulation. Without adequate ventilation, condensation can form inside the roofing system, leading to issues such as mold growth, material deterioration, and structural damage. Additionally, poor airflow can cause heat to build up beneath the roof surface, accelerating wear and increasing cooling costs for the building’s interior. Installing vents helps mitigate these issues by promoting continuous airflow, thereby protecting the roof and interior spaces from moisture-related and heat-related problems.

Material and Size Costs - The cost for flat roof vent installation varies based on the vent type and roof size, typically ranging from $200 to $600. Larger or more complex installations may increase costs accordingly.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for installing roof vents generally fall between $150 and $400 per project, depending on roof accessibility and complexity. Some providers may include labor in their overall project estimates.
Additional Materials - Costs for supplementary materials such as flashing or sealing components usually add $50 to $150 to the total. These are necessary for ensuring proper vent function and waterproofing.
Overall Project Cost - The total expense for flat roof vent installation can range from approximately $300 to $1,000, depending on the specific requirements and local service provider rates.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to individual roof con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
